大数据分析要学什么数学
-
大数据分析是一种通过收集、处理和分析大规模数据来提取有价值信息和洞察的方法。在进行大数据分析时,数学是一个至关重要的基础,它帮助我们理解数据背后的模式、趋势和关系。以下是在学习大数据分析时需要掌握的数学知识:
-
统计学:统计学是大数据分析的基础,它包括描述性统计、概率论、假设检验、方差分析等内容。统计学帮助我们理解数据的分布、可靠性和推断性,从而做出合理的数据分析和决策。
-
线性代数:线性代数是大数据处理和机器学习的基础,它涉及矩阵运算、向量空间、特征值分解等内容。在大数据分析中,线性代数常用于处理高维数据、构建模型和进行特征工程。
-
微积分:微积分是数学建模和优化的基础,它包括导数、积分、极限等内容。在大数据分析中,微积分常用于优化算法、求解梯度和构建数学模型。
-
机器学习:机器学习是大数据分析的重要工具,它涉及监督学习、无监督学习、强化学习等内容。在学习机器学习时,需要掌握基本的数学知识,如概率论、统计学和线性代数。
-
数据挖掘:数据挖掘是大数据分析的重要技术,它包括聚类分析、关联规则挖掘、分类预测等内容。在学习数据挖掘时,需要掌握统计学、线性代数和机器学习等数学知识。
总之,学习大数据分析需要具备扎实的数学基础,包括统计学、线性代数、微积分、机器学习和数据挖掘等知识。掌握这些数学知识可以帮助我们更好地理解数据、构建模型、优化算法和做出有效的数据分析和决策。因此,在学习大数据分析时,要注重数学基础的学习和应用,以提高数据分析的质量和效果。
1年前 -
-
要学习大数据分析需要掌握的数学知识主要包括概率论与统计学、线性代数和微积分。下面将详细介绍这三个方面的数学知识在大数据分析中的重要性和应用。
概率论与统计学
概率论与统计学是大数据分析中不可或缺的数学基础。概率论主要研究随机现象的规律性,而统计学则是利用样本数据去推断总体特征。在大数据分析中,概率论与统计学主要用于数据的采样、推断和预测。例如,通过概率分布和统计模型来描述数据的特征和变化规律,从而进行数据的抽样和推断。此外,统计学中的假设检验和置信区间等方法也被广泛应用于大数据分析中,用于验证数据的可靠性和进行决策。线性代数
线性代数是大数据分析中的另一个重要数学工具,主要用于描述和处理数据的结构和关系。在大数据分析中,数据通常以矩阵或向量的形式存在,线性代数提供了丰富的工具和方法来处理这些数据。例如,矩阵运算、特征值分解和奇异值分解等方法可以用于降维、特征提取和数据压缩,从而帮助分析师更好地理解和利用数据。微积分
微积分是描述和分析数据变化规律的重要数学工具。在大数据分析中,微积分主要用于建立和优化数据模型,例如通过求导和积分来寻找数据的极值点和面积,从而进行数据的优化和预测。此外,微积分中的梯度下降和拉格朗日乘子等方法也被广泛应用于大数据分析中,用于求解最优化和约束条件下的问题。总之,概率论与统计学、线性代数和微积分是大数据分析中不可或缺的数学基础,掌握这些数学知识可以帮助分析师更好地理解和利用数据,从而进行更深入和准确的大数据分析。
1年前 -
要进行大数据分析,需要掌握一定的数学知识。以下是大数据分析中常用的数学知识点:
-
统计学基础
- 概率论:掌握概率的基本概念、概率分布、随机变量等知识,对于理解数据分布和不确定性具有重要意义。
- 统计推断:了解统计推断的基本原理,包括参数估计、假设检验等内容,可以帮助分析数据的可靠性和代表性。
-
线性代数
- 矩阵运算:熟悉矩阵的基本运算、矩阵分解、特征值分解等内容,对于处理大规模数据具有重要意义。
- 向量空间:理解向量空间、内积空间等概念,对于理解数据之间的关系和相似性具有帮助。
-
微积分
- 导数和积分:掌握导数和积分的基本概念和运算法则,对于理解数据的变化趋势和求解最优化问题有帮助。
- 概率密度函数:了解概率密度函数和累积分布函数的概念,对于分析数据的分布和概率特征有帮助。
-
优化理论
- 凸优化:了解凸优化的基本理论和算法,对于解决大规模数据分析中的最优化问题具有重要意义。
- 非线性优化:熟悉非线性优化的方法和技巧,对于拟合模型、参数优化等问题有帮助。
-
数据挖掘
- 聚类分析:了解聚类分析的原理和方法,对于发现数据中的类别和群体具有帮助。
- 回归分析:掌握回归分析的基本原理和模型,对于分析变量之间的因果关系有帮助。
以上是大数据分析中常用的数学知识点,掌握这些数学知识可以帮助分析师更好地理解和分析大规模数据,并从中获取有用的信息和洞见。
1年前 -


